Exceptional Installation Flexibility and Scalability
Solar panels ground mount systems provide unmatched installation flexibility that accommodates diverse property layouts, soil conditions, and energy requirements while offering seamless scalability for future expansion needs. Unlike rooftop installations limited by available roof space and structural capacity, solar panels ground mount configurations can utilize any suitable land area, from small backyard installations to expansive commercial solar farms. The modular design principles enable property owners to start with smaller systems and expand incrementally as energy needs grow or budget allows, making renewable energy adoption more accessible and financially manageable. Professional installers can adapt solar panels ground mount systems to challenging terrain including sloped surfaces, rocky ground, or areas with poor soil conditions through specialized foundation techniques like helical piers or ballasted systems. This adaptability ensures that property owners with unconventional site conditions can still benefit from solar energy generation without compromising system stability or performance. The independent nature of solar panels ground mount installations eliminates the complex structural engineering assessments required for rooftop systems, particularly on older buildings or structures with weight limitations. Installation teams can position arrays at optimal distances from buildings and property lines while maintaining compliance with local zoning regulations and setback requirements.
